Halewood International is to launch a new variety of its Crabbie's drinks brand aimed at 'ginger and ale connoisseurs'.

Crabbie's Black, a 6% alcoholic ginger beer, will be targeted at "a slightly older, more demanding male audience". It follows the launch of Crabbie's Alcoholic Ginger Beer in 2009.

The new drink will be supported by a consumer press campaign fronted by Alan Hansen as well as in-store and outdoor sampling, trade press and point of sale.

Richard Clark, director of innovation at Halewood International, said: “Our research has shown there’s a strong demand for additional expansion of the Crabbie’s portfolio by creating more distinct tasting products for our consumers to enjoy.

"Real Ales with higher ABVs are currently experiencing growth in both the On Trade and Take Home markets, providing a timely opportunity to launch Crabbie’s Black.”
